    While national and provincial departments do not make this week’s roundup of top government ICT tenders, the ICT industry will not be disappointed at the selection of newly-advertised tenders and a particularly interesting request for information. The information request comes from the South African Revenue Service (SARS) and follows its recent allocation of an additional R4 billion over the medium-term by National Treasury to modernise its operations and enhance taxpayer services.

    Activity on National Treasury’s eTenders Portal leant towards lower-value quotation requests last week, as government departments reassessed their procurement priorities based on finance minister Enoch Godongwana’s latest budget proposal. Given the somewhat dull week, the South African Broadcasting Corporation (SABC) takes the spotlight with a request for information on an integrated system for internal audit and governance, risk and compliance (GRC).

    Finance minister Enoch Godongwana’s delivery of his third National Budget has resulted in a lull on National Treasury’s eTenders Portal, as government departments take the time to understand how their budget allocations will be impacted by spending cuts. Meanwhile, the South African National Energy Development Institute (Sanedi) is focused on enhancing the monitoring, analysis and management of National Treasury’s Smart Meter Grant Project (SMG).
